Ever hear of otters eating all the bass in a pond?
A pond I use to fish got wiped out by a family of 6 otters. They showed up one night (the owner assumes by a creek that runs into the pond), and wiped the pond out in 1 summer. The banks were littered with chewed fish carcasses and scales. The bass that were left were much skinnier than normal, I assume because their prey was scarce. Thankfully, the otters left as suddenly as they appeared and hopefully the pond will come back. In a big body of water, there's no way they're hurting anything though. I do avoid areas I see them in though as I'm sure the bass don't try to hang around where they're actively hunting at.

Anyone use the Plano EDGE Jig box for Jerkbaits too?
Just make sure they don't get left in the sun. The clear lid acts like a magnifying glass in the sun and bakes them. I lost almost 20 Duo, Lucky Craft, and a Megabass in just a few hours on a spring day because I left my box out on the deck and they got cooked, expanded and exploded or bent.

Wiggle wart?
The most desirable version was the "Pre Rapala" version, before Rapala bough out Storm, but that was 20+ years ago. The newer version is supposed to be closer to the old ones than the last run was, but I haven't fished on to say for sure. They run that deep, but a WW shines in 3-7 feet of water just slowly bumping along. If it's really cold, you just pull it along with your rod.
